Transaction 2f723363b3c9238f9fc8dbcbe2cc624bb0144a16e5689a3817d54dd656e58d40
1 Input
1 Output
-
2f723363b3c9238f9fc8dbcbe2cc624bb0144a16e5689a3817d54dd656e58d40:0
- value
- 654697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fdd6608690b96ab72dddcdb57fb10200dad77fed OP_EQUAL
- address
- 3QqBhFnEnSyEutj5heoNcwksLoKkELLr7k